CHAPTER 2 RYDER RESURFACES

last update Last Updated: 2025-02-23 11:39:43

She gasped for air, her lungs burning as the foul liquid splashed across her face and dripped on the icy floor. Alex's mocking laughter echoed against the walls, making her flesh crawl."Pathetic?" he said."You are the pathetic one, Alex. she said, her voice quivering with wrath and embarrassment. You are so blinded by your hatred and wrath that you cannot see the truth.”

Alex's laughter died down, and he took a step closer to her, his eyes blazing with contempt. "The truth?" he sneered. "You mean the truth about how you killed my mother?"

Nora's eyes welled up with tears as she felt a fresh wave of pain wash over her. "I didn't kill your mother, Alex," she whispered, her voice cracking. "I swear it. You have to believe me."

Alex's expression didn't change."I don't believe you," he said, his voice dripping with malice. "And even if I did, it wouldn't matter. You're still a murderer in my eyes."

Nora felt a stinging sensation in her eyes as tears began to fall, streaming down her face like rain. She felt a sob building in her chest, but she swallowed it down, refusing to give Alex the satisfaction of seeing her beast. Instead, she stood tall, her eyes locked on Alex's, and said, "You're making a mistake, Alex. A big one."

Alex raised an eyebrow, a smirk playing on his lips. "Oh? And what's that?"

Nora's voice was steady, her words dripping with conviction. "You're going to regret this, Alex. Regret the day you ever doubted me."

Alex's smirk faltered for a moment, and Nora saw a glimmer of uncertainty in his eyes. But it was quickly replaced by his usual arrogance.

"I doubt it," he said, turning to walk away. "You're nothing but a murderer, Nora. And you'll pay for what you've done.”

Another omega fisted her hand into Nora's 

Thick long red hair and yanked it. Nora let out a scream of agony. Another wave of laughter swept through the room. Nora sucked in the air; her wolf was threatening to explode. Unlike her, she didn't care about the consequences.“Piece of trash, your existence is worthless. Maybe that's why no one loves you.” She mocked.

At that, Nora's control snapped. She let out a rumbling growl as her irises turned dark with red rings around them. The laughter and mockery ceased immediately.

Alex, her mate and the Alpha of Zodak Pack growled, pushing away the ladies that surrounded him. His eyes flashed golden as he grabbed her.

“Return to her subconscious, wolf!” He gritted out, his dominance rippled through her body. Almost immediately, her eyes returned to their normal color and she let out an agonized cry. Grinning gleefully, Alex let her fall back to the ground, and the chair to which she was tied shattered under her weight.

“I thought I told you not to let your wolf exert control! Did what they said hurt you? They're right. You're useless and you'll forever be. That's why your father asked me to take you as a maid immediately, I rejected you as my Luna. He rather let me have you as a maid so you will never come back home, he knew how much of a waste you would be.”

Tears spilled out from Nora's eyes. She could take every form of pain, insult, and injury, but nothing hurt more than the reminder that she was truly useless and could never result in anything good. The words Alex was saying were nothing but the truth and now she wished someone could end her misery.

“Open your eyes,” he commanded, and she obeyed.

He gave her a dirty look and then knocked her off with his heel.

********

Her head throbbed as she managed to drag herself to the bathroom; she was forced to begin working as a maid in Alex and Eve's home. Every task seemed like a reminder of her humiliation. She cleaned floors, prepared meals, and put up with Eve's relentless taunting.

She sat in the corner of the tiny room assigned to her at Alex and Eve's home. It was nothing more than a thin storage room, with a flimsy mattress on the floor and a single candle flickering in the dark. She stared at her hands, her thoughts whirling. 

“I can't live like this,” I  would not. 

A faint knock on the door shocked her. Before she could react, the door cracked open, and Mary crept inside. Her eyes were filled with shame and sadness. 

"Nora," She muttered.

"I'm very sorry."I should have—" 

"Don't," she shouted abruptly, cutting her short. 

"Do not apologize. I understand why you didn't help me.

"The law is stronger than friendship." Her shoulders slumped. 

"I despise this pack and its laws. "What they've done to you is unfair.”

She turned away, unable to bear the pity in her gaze.

"What do you want, Mary?

"She paused before speaking."I believe Eve is hiding something.

I overheard her talking with someone in the forest yesterday. She mentioned a deal and your name.

Her heart skips a beat. "A deal?

"Yes," She replied, leaning closer.

"I don't know all the circumstances, but I believe it has something to do with Alex's mother.

Her fists clenched, her face turning crimson….”What might Eve possibly have to do with Alex's mother's passing”?

Then, the door cracked open, and Eve appeared in the doorway, a mischievous smirk on her face.

"Ah, Mary," she murmured, her voice full of bitterness.

"I see you are still attempting to protect Nora. How... quaint."

"Mary's eyes narrowed, and she took a step back as if preparing to protect herself before hurriedly leaving the room.

But, before she could say anything, Eve dropped a bombshell: "Nora, you have a visitor."Someone who has waited a long time to see you.

Visitor?..her heart fell, and she felt a shiver down her spine.

Who might it be? Eve stepped back, revealing a figure shrouded in shadow.

And as the figure stepped forward, she felt her world turn upside down.
